Common Name: Egremont Russet Apple
Scientific Name: Malus domestica
Flavor Profile: Sweet, rich, nutty
Fruit Texture: Firm and aromatic
Primary Uses: Fresh eating, cider, preserves
Plant Type: Deciduous fruit tree
Growth Habit: Medium vigor, rounded canopy
Sunlight Requirement: Full sun
Soil Preference: Well-drained, fertile soil
Watering: Moderate; avoid waterlogging
Climate Suitability: Cool to temperate regions
Hardiness Zones: 5–8
Seed Type: Non-GMO
Germination Time: 3–8 weeks (requires cold stratification)
Time to Fruit: 3–5 years after planting
Best Planting Season: Late winter to early spring
Place seeds in a moist paper towel and seal in a plastic bag.
Refrigerate for 6–8 weeks to simulate winter dormancy.
After stratification, plant seeds ½ inch deep in seed-starting soil.
Keep soil gently moist and position in bright, warm light.
When seedlings are strong, transplant outdoors in a sunny location.
Apply mulch at the base to maintain moisture and support healthy roots.
